the pillows Announce Disbandment After 35 Years of Music
Legendary Japanese rock band the pillows announced their disbandment on February 1. Following their January 31 concert, they officially ended their 35-year career, expressing gratitude to their fans.

Tetsuya Komuro and Daisuke Asakura’s Unit PANDORA Returns After Seven Years
PANDORA, the duo of Tetsuya Komuro and Daisuke Asakura, resumes activities after a seven-year hiatus. A live show with Takanori Nishikawa and Beverly will be held on February 28 at Zepp DiverCity in Tokyo.

TM NETWORK Announces New Single “Carry on the Memories”
TM NETWORK unveils details of their single “Carry on the Memories,” featuring three nostalgic tracks born from live tour rehearsals. The release includes an analog edition available on March 26.
